What is Stellar Blade?
Stellar Blade is a next-gen action RPG known for:
- Cinematic Sci-Fi Storyline
- Fast-paced, anime-style combat
- Console-level visual fidelity
- Immersive environments and boss battles
Previously available only on PlayStation consoles, this title is now accessible to mobile users via cloud technology.
What is CyberCloud?
CyberCloud is a Chinese cloud gaming emulator that allows users to stream and play console-quality games on Android devices. Unlike other emulators that require large downloads or high-end specifications, CyberCloud runs the game from the cloud — meaning:
- No installation of large files
- Minimal lag with stable internet
- Console-level graphics on mobile

What You’ll Need
Before you begin, ensure you have the following:
✅ An Android phone (mid-range or higher)
✅ Chinese VPN app (e.g., HelloVPN, FlyVPN, or PandaVPN)
✅ CyberCloud APK (from the official site or trusted forums)
✅ Stable internet connection (minimum 10 Mbps recommended)
Step-by-Step Setup Guide
Step 1: Install a Chinese VPN
- Go to the Play Store or official website and download a VPN that offers Chinese servers.
- Install and open the VPN app.
- Connect to a Mainland China server.
Step 2: Download and Install CyberCloud Emulator
- Visit the official CyberCloud website or a trusted community (like TapTap or GitHub).
- Download the CyberCloud APK file.
- Enable “Install from Unknown Sources” on your device.
- Install the APK file.
Step 3: Launch CyberCloud and Create Account
- Open the CyberCloud app.
- Sign up using an email or phone number (some versions may require a QQ or WeChat account).
- Browse or search for Stellar Blade in the app interface.
Step 4: Play Stellar Blade
- Tap on the game and hit “Start” or “Play”.
- The game will stream directly to your device.
- Connect a Bluetooth controller for an even better experience (optional but recommended).

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q1: Is it legal to use CyberCloud?
A: CyberCloud operates in a legal grey area, especially for international users. It’s important to use this tool only for personal and non-commercial purposes.
Q2: Is a VPN mandatory?
A: Yes. Without a Chinese IP address, the CyberCloud app may not connect or load properly.
Q3: Can I play other games too?
A: Absolutely! CyberCloud supports several console and PC titles besides Stellar Blade.
Q4: Do I need a high-end phone?
A: Not really. As the game runs on the cloud, most of the heavy lifting is done server-side. Even a mid-range device should deliver smooth gameplay.
Q5: What about in-game language support?
A: The CyberCloud interface and game may default to Chinese. You can usually switch language settings within the game if supported.
